程序代写代做 Java html 辽宁科技学院

辽宁科技学院
本科毕业论文开题报告

题目:
移动考勤系统
专题:

系别:
曙光大数据学院
专 业:
计算机科学与技术
班级:

学生姓名:

学号:

指导教师:

2020 年 2 月 25 日

本课题的目的及意义,研究现状分析
随着“移动互联网”时代的来临,迫切需要更科学先进的解决方案——“移动考勤系统”来解决诸如实时性、准确性、跨地域性及管理性的各类问题。这种方式易出错、成本高、不透明,无法解决代考、脱岗问题。因此,设计移动考勤是有必要和有社会经济效益的。
这套系统(云平台)主要是为了实现企业可针对不同地域、职位、职级、部门、员工等灵活设置不同的考勤规则,包括自由考勤、弹性考勤、固定时间、倒班考勤、单双周考勤等多种规则,满足企业不同管理方式下个性化的考勤需求。分析出工作状态和责任感。主要包括前端、后台、移动子系统,主要内容有考勤管理,挖掘统计、后台服务,系统安全。
移动考勤又称为 HYPERLINK “https://baike.baidu.com/item/LBS” \t “https://baike.baidu.com/item/%E7%A7%BB%E5%8A%A8%E8%80%83%E5%8B%A4/_blank” LBS考勤,是基于移动通讯网络和互联网的 HYPERLINK “https://baike.baidu.com/item/%E8%80%83%E5%8B%A4%E7%B3%BB%E7%BB%9F/6243614” \t “https://baike.baidu.com/item/%E7%A7%BB%E5%8A%A8%E8%80%83%E5%8B%A4/_blank” 考勤系统,由无线终端和网络管理平台组成,来确定某人在某一时间所处于的位置。
移动考勤改变传统仅依赖时间轴作为参考手段的考核办法,是新一代的考勤系统。管理者可以通过任何一台能够上网的计算机或手机,就能查询和管理考勤。它将逐步取代传统考勤系统。
二、国内外研究现状(文献综述)
国内外所有的公司不论是什么规模,什么行业都有自己的考勤系统和考勤制度。很早以前是由专门的人员来记录员工的出勤情况,现在,随着电子和计算机技术的发展,出现了多种考勤系统。  
在国内,GPS手机定位考勤系统几乎没有任何一家公司曾经推出过。 
  对比分析国内外知名的企业考勤系统,对比较优秀的考勤系统的功能和考勤方式进行归纳总结。应用GPS定位技术和移动平台开发技术设计一款手机定位考勤系统,一定会迎合市场需求,给企业带来便利。整个系统分为两部分:系统服务平台和手机终端平台。使用户可以通过手机终端登陆考勤系统完成一次考勤操作,手机终端将所在位置的物理坐标(即经纬度)和考勤人员的登录信息(员工编号,姓名、部门和考勤时间)通过GPRS网络、3G网络或者WiFi(无线局域网络)发生到服务系统,系统服务平台能够根据手机终端将手机终端发送过来的考勤信息保持到数据存储系统,并能够形成各种统计分析数据及图表。 
三、本课题的基本任务、拟解决的主要问题,及其实现途径、方法和手段

移动考勤系统设计框架

主要功能如下:
1.考勤管理
1)员工信息管理:对员工信息进行查询,修改,增加,删除,信息导出等功能。
2)员工移动考勤管理:客户端会根据系统时间自行判断签到和签退的请求。
3)考勤记录管理:普通用户可以通过考勤记录来查询个人特定时间的考勤记录;管理员不仅可以通过考勤记录来查询特定员工特定时间的考勤记录,还能对这些记录进行修改。
4)考勤点管理:维护考勤的地点名称、经纬坐标信息、指定的签到签退时间信息。
5)考勤策略管理:维护考勤超时范围、考勤距离范围,作为考勤点管理的辅助拓展信息管理功能。
6)请假管理:员工的请假申请,各级审核,销假等管理和追踪。
2.挖掘统计
1)员工请假统计:对员工的时间、部门、级别等进行画像分析展示。
2)员工考勤统计:生成多维度的统计报表。
3)企业管理统计:企业管理层对员工考勤进行全面挖掘与分析统计查询。

3、通过可视化结果更深层次挖掘员工的情况,比如请假原因,突然缺勤原因。
4、移动考勤系统的受益群众是公司、企业的员工。
设计要求
本系统能够采用HTML+CSS设计框架,使用echarts图表,每个功能应按照标准化代码文档的书写,实现大数据技术和思维的代表性、先进性和作品创新性。
开发中使用采用MySQL数据库,使用java语言,通过Dashboard来展示最终应用效果,达到实用先进的目的。
完成本课题所需工作条件(如工具书、计算机、实验、调研等),可能遇到的问题以及解决的方法和措施
所需工作条件:
工具书
1)大数据语言python
2)java设计
3)数据可视化
2、计算机
1)win10系统
2)内存:4G
3、实验环境
1)数据库:mysql
2)Pycharm、Myeclipse
通过了解任务书从里面看到的有几点功能是特别复杂的,在做的过程中有很大困难。
(1)考勤点管理:维护考勤的地点名称、经纬坐标信息、指定的签到签退时间信息。
(2)考勤策略管理:维护考勤超时范围、考勤距离范围,作为考勤点管理的辅助拓展信息管理功能。
在做毕业设计时我会尽量问同学问老师查找相关资料解决这两点难题。

五、已查阅参考文献目录
[1]《大数据技术原理与应用(第2版)》 林子雨 人民邮电出版社 2017-01-01
[2]《大数据时代的统计学思维》 刘强 水利水电出版社 2018-05-01
[3]《基于python的大数据分析及实战》 余本国 水利水电出版社 2018-07-01
[4]《企业级大数据平台构建:架构与实现》 朱凯 机械工业出版社 2018-04-25
[5]《Java面向对象程序设计》 贺伟,李凤   HYPERLINK “http://www.cqvip.com/main/search.aspx?o=%e9%98%bf%e5%9d%9d%e5%b8%88%e8%8c%83%e5%ad%a6%e9%99%a2%e7%94%b5%e5%ad%90%e4%bf%a1%e6%81%af%e4%b8%8e%e8%87%aa%e5%8a%a8%e5%8c%96%e5%ad%a6%e9%99%a2” 阿坝师范学院电子信息与自动化学院 2019-01-13
[6]《数据可视化与挖掘技术实践》 朱希安 知识产权出版社 2017-07-27
[7]《JAVA程序设计》 陈实 中国多媒体与网络教学学报 2019-01-04
[8]《java从入门到精通(第5版)》 明日科技 清华大学出版社 2019-03-01
[9]《基于Java和MySQL的图书馆信息化管理系统设计》 黄文娟 电子设计工程 2019-02-24
[10]《Foundation of Big Data Analytics》 Gangmin Li Science Press 2019-06-01

六、进程安排
序号
时间要求
应完成的内容(任务)提要
1
2020年1月16日-2020年3月1日
选题、调研、搜集资料
2
2020年3月2日至2020年4月3日
利用毕业实习完成的工作:
设计需求分析
总体设计
概要设计
数据采集与存储处理
数据库设计
建模与挖掘分析设计
数据可视化设计
3
2020年3月30日—4月3日
毕业设计开题
4
2020年4月4日-2020年5月10日
系统详细设计(数据库设计、建模与挖掘分析设计、数据可视化分析等设计),编写代码、完成各功能模块。这期间要对毕业设计文档进行整理和归类,撰写论文初稿。
5
2020年5月11日-2020年5月15日
中期检查
6
2020年5月16日-2020年5月24日
完成论文初稿、完成程序部分设计任务
7
2020年5月25日-2020年5月31日
论文、程序完善与修改
8
2020年5月25日-2020年6月14日
论文查重、定稿、打印、上交程序
9
2020年6月15日-2020年6月21日
准备答辩

2020年6月22日-2020年6月25日
答辩

指导教师意见:

指导教师(签字): 年 月 日

教研室审查意见:

专业教研室主任(签字): 年 月 日

移动考勤系统

员工登录

员工管理

考勤管理

普通员工
登录

管理员登录

员工信息管理

员工移动考勤管理

考勤记录

考勤点管理管理

挖掘统计

员工请假统计

员工考勤统计

企业管理统计

考勤策略管理

请假管理